Planning Your Weekend Bathroom Refresh
Embarking on a bathroom refresh over the weekend can be an exciting yet daunting endeavor. To ensure a smooth and successful project, it is essential to create a detailed action plan before diving in. This planning phase not only helps you stay organized, but it also maximizes the use of your time and resources within the limited 48-hour window.
Budgeting is a crucial component of this plan. Start by assessing your financial resources and setting a realistic budget for materials and tools required for the bathroom refresh. Consider the scope of your project—simple cosmetic changes might require less funding than extensive renovations. Be prepared to allocate funds for essential tasks, such as caulk replacement, fixture updates, and any unforeseen expenses that may arise.
Identifying the tasks that need immediate attention is another critical aspect of your planning. Evaluate the current state of your bathroom, focusing on areas that are most in need of improvement. For instance, if the caulk around your bathtub is deteriorating, it should be prioritized to prevent water damage. Take a close look at your fixtures as well—replace any outdated or malfunctioning components to enhance both aesthetics and functionality.
Additionally, determine if any structural changes are necessary during your refresh. Perhaps new shelving or a different shower layout would make better use of the space. Once you have listed your tasks, establish a rough timeline for your weekend, breaking down each action into manageable chunks. By assigning time limits to each task, you can efficiently track your progress and make necessary adjustments along the way.
In summary, adequate planning is key to a successful bathroom refresh. By budgeting effectively, identifying priority tasks, and creating a structured timeline, you can transform your bathroom without the stress often associated with renovation projects. This methodical approach will ensure that your weekend is productive and enjoyable.
Essential Tools and Materials List
Embarking on a weekend bathroom refresh requires careful planning, particularly when it comes to assembling the right tools and materials. A comprehensive shopping list ensures that your project runs smoothly and efficiently. Below is an inventory of essential items you will need for your bathroom upgrade.
Tools: A caulking gun is indispensable for applying silicone or caulk around sinks, tubs, and fixtures. A grout float is essential for resetting tiles or refreshing grout lines. Additionally, a tape measure ensures accurate measurements, while a level guarantees that installations, such as shelves or mirrors, are perfectly aligned. Pliers and a wrench will be needed for tightening or loosening plumbing fixtures. Don’t forget a utility knife, which is useful for cutting various materials during the project.
Materials: Begin by selecting your desired paint, suited for wet environments to resist mold and mildew. A durable bathroom-specific primer is also recommended. For flooring updates, vinyl tiles or laminate can provide a fresh look with ease of maintenance. If you are updating your fixtures, ensure you have the correct sink, faucet, and lighting to match your style. Don’t overlook decorative elements like mirrors and towel racks, which can significantly enhance aesthetics.

Step-by-Step Weekend Action Plan
Embarking on a bathroom refresh over the course of a weekend can be a fulfilling yet challenging endeavor. A practical and realistic timeline will help ensure that each task is completed without feeling overwhelmed. This plan outlines what to accomplish each day, allowing for a smooth transition from the old to the new within your space.
Friday Evening: Preparation – Before the weekend kicks off, spend your Friday evening gathering all the necessary materials and tools. Create a checklist to include items such as caulk, grout, fixtures, and cleaning supplies. This preparation is essential, as it helps minimize unnecessary trips to the hardware store during your refresh journey. Dedicate this time to remove any decor or items that could obstruct your work.
Saturday Morning: Caulking and Grouting – Start your day early. Typically, caulking around the tub and sink can take 1-2 hours, depending on your proficiency. The aim is to ensure all areas are sealed properly to prevent water damage. Once that is complete, freshening up the grout can be accomplished in a similar timeframe, lending a clean and polished look to your tile work.
Saturday Afternoon: Fixture Installation – After a lunch break, commence with installing new fixtures, such as faucets and towel racks. This phase generally requires 2-3 hours and may involve some minor plumbing work, so it’s advisable to have instructions or manuals handy. If you encounter any plumbing issues, allows an extra hour or two for troubleshooting.
Sunday Morning: Mirror Swapping – Transition to updating the aesthetics by swapping out mirrors. This task can usually be completed in about an hour. Ensure you have all tools such as a drill or screwdriver ready, as removing the old mirror and securely mounting the new one is critical for safety.
Sunday Afternoon: Final Touch-Ups – Reserve this time for a final inspection and any last touches, allowing for up to 2-3 hours. This might include repainting walls, organizing storage, or simply cleaning up the renovated space. Pay attention to any unexpected issues that may arise, and be ready to adapt your timeline if necessary.
By adhering to this structured action plan, you maximize your weekend efficiency while refreshing your bathroom. Set realistic expectations, allowing for flexibility, and celebrate your accomplishments throughout the process.
Final Touches and Maintenance Tips
As your weekend bathroom refresh approaches completion, it is imperative to focus on the final touches that will elevate the overall aesthetic and functionality of the space. Start by incorporating decorative elements such as stylish towels, artful wall hangings, or a carefully selected shower curtain. These accents not only enhance the visual appeal but can also reflect your personal style, thereby making the bathroom a more inviting place.
Additionally, consider adding plants or candles to introduce natural beauty and a sense of tranquility. Incorporating subtle lighting through fixtures or decorative lighting can further enhance the ambience, particularly in a smaller bathroom.
Once you have refined the bathroom’s look, it is crucial to implement a maintenance routine to preserve your hard work. A regular cleaning schedule will help maintain the new upgrades, especially in high-moisture areas. Ensure to use non-abrasive cleaners that are suitable for the materials present in your bathroom, from tiles to fixtures. Furthermore, it is advisable to check caulking around sinks and tubs periodically to prevent mold and water damage, which can jeopardize your renovations.
Consider a long-term care plan that includes occasional inspections for plumbing issues or structural wear. In cases where extensive renovations or specialized installations are needed, it may be wise to seek professional assistance. Skilled professionals can provide expertise that ensures the longevity of your bathroom upgrades, particularly when it comes to plumbing or electrical work, which should be handled by certified individuals for safety and compliance with regulations.
By carefully choosing your decorative elements and implementing a sound maintenance plan, you can enjoy a refreshed bathroom that remains both practical and aesthetically pleasing for years to come.
